How they compare
Pakistan currently reports 5,142 current US$ per square kilometre against 4,787 current US$ per square kilometre in Ethiopia, a difference of 355 current US$ per square kilometre.
That makes Pakistan's figure about 1.1 times Ethiopia's.
The two have swapped places 13 times across 31 shared years of data; in 1993 it was Ethiopia ahead.
Ethiopia ranks 81st and Pakistan ranks 78th of 168 countries.
Across the 4 decades both report, Ethiopia averaged higher in 1 and Pakistan in 3.

About this data
Net official development assistance received (current US$) divided by Land area (sq. km), matched on country and year. Neither publisher issues this ratio as a series; it is computed here from both.
